For seven-position transmission: Measure the 3rd, 4th, and 5th clutch pressures.
-1.
|
Start the engine, and shift to D3, then press the accelerator pedal slowly until reaching 3rd gear.
|
-2.
|
Measure the 3rd clutch pressure at the 3rd clutch pressure inspection port while holding the engine speed at 2,000 rpm (min
−1
).
|
-3.
|
Shift to D, and measure the 4th clutch pressure at the 4th clutch pressure inspection port.
|
-4.
|
Measure the 5th clutch pressure at the 5th clutch pressure inspection port while holding the engine speed at 2,000 rpm (min
−1
).
|
-
For five-position transmission: Measure the 3rd, 4th, and 5th clutch pressures.
-1.
|
Start the engine, and shift to S.
|
-2.
|
Upshift to 3rd gear by pulling the paddle shifter +, and measure the 3rd clutch pressure at the 3rd clutch pressure inspection port while holding the engine speed at 2,000 rpm (min
−1
).
|
-3.
|
Upshift to 4th gear by pulling the paddle shifter +, and measure the 4th clutch pressure at the 4th clutch pressure inspection port while holding the engine speed at 2,000 rpm (min
−1
).
|
-4.
|
Upshift to 5th gear by pulling the paddle shifter +, and measure the 5th clutch pressure at the 5th clutch pressure inspection port while holding the engine speed at 2,000 rpm (min
−1
).

-
Bring the engine back to an idle, then press the brake pedal to stop the wheels from rotating.
-
Shift to R, then release the brake pedal. Raise the engine speed to 2,000 rpm (min
−1
), and measure the 5th clutch pressure at the 5th clutch pressure inspection port.

-
Turn the engine off, then disconnect the oil pressure gauges from the 3rd, 4th, and 5th clutch pressure inspection ports.
-
Install the sealing bolts in the 3rd, 4th, and 5th clutch pressure inspection ports with the new sealing washers, and tighten the bolts to 18 N·m (1.8 kgf·m, 13 lbf·ft). Do not reuse the old sealing washer.
